#dc5d60 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#dc5d60 is composed of 86.3% red, 36.5%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 57.7% magenta, 56.4%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 358.6 degrees, a saturation of 64.5% and a lightness of 61.4%. #dc5d60 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ffbac0 with #b90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#dc5d60 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#dc5d60 has RGB values of R:220, G:93,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.58, Y:0.56,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 14441824.

Shades and Tints of #dc5d60
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0304 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.
